Resumen

Polycrystalline samples of the (CuInTe2)1-x (FeTe)x alloy system where prepared by the melt and anneal technique and the products characterized by X-Ray Diffraction (XRD), Differential Thermal Analysis (DTA) and Optical Diffuse Reflectance Spectroscopy (ODRS) techniques. A first sight, samples were composed by a tetragonal phase with traces of a secondary phase identified as Fe1.125Te. Under exhaustive examination, it was found that the tetragonal phase, at the same time, is composed by two phases, with the same crystal structure and close lattice parameters, typical of spinodal decomposition. From ODRS measurements, optical absorption vs energy curves was obtained. These curves show how the addition of Fe produces a disordering-reordering process in the cationic sublattice suggesting that composition x=0.5 (CuFeInTe3) could be an intermediate compound in the diagram. Using the obtained information, a preliminary T-x phase diagram is proposed.
